British Fashion at the Met

Filed under: News

It's a good time to be in New York. The worst heat of summer is gone, the fall social scene is starting up, and the US Open is in full swing ... but what's even hotter than all that is the Metropolitan Museum of Art's exhibit on UK fashion.

"AngloMania: Tradition and Transgression in British Fashion" focuses on the years 1976 to 2006, and reminds us that we owe a lot more to British fashion than punk haircuts and those funny-looking beefeater hats.

Still not convinced that you should go to a museum instead of going shopping on Fifth Avenue? What if I told you that the exhibit is underwritten by Burberry? Now are you willing to go to the Met?

Good. But you best hurry. The exhibit's last day is September 4.
